Description

Each player in turn throws a number die and moves along his line of advance by the number thrown until he reaches the middle space 13. This space can only be reached if the corresponding number of free spaces is rolled. If, on the other hand, the player has thrown more eyes than there are spaces up to 13, he must wait until he rolls the right number. The player now has the right to roll two number dice and the movement die immediately after his last roll.
The player advances or retreats to the number that results from the calculation of the symbols and numbers on the three dice.
During the game, the play money regulations indicated at the edge of the game board apply.
If a figure hits a space occupied by the other player, it is moved back by one space.
From the spaces of numbers 76 to 91 you only play with the two number dice, from the number 92 to the end only with one number die. The number 100 can only be reached in the same way as the number 13.
